Physiological Effects of Trace Elements and Chemicals in Water
Varma, M. M.; And Others
Journal of Environmental Health, 39, 2, 90-100, 76
The physiological effects on humans and animals of trace amounts of organic and unorganic pollutants in natural and waste waters are examined. The sensitivity of particular organs and species is emphasized. Substances reviewed include mercury, arsenic, cadmium, lead, chromium, fluorides, nitrates and organics, including polychlounated biphenyls. (BT)
